Kuwait Arrhythmia Monitoring Devices Market Overview
The Kuwait Arrhythmia Monitoring Devices Market is valued at USD 10 million, based on a five-year historical analysis. This growth is primarily driven by the increasing prevalence of cardiovascular diseases, rising geriatric population, and advancements in technology that enhance monitoring capabilities. The demand for arrhythmia monitoring devices has surged as healthcare providers focus on early detection and management of heart conditions, leading to improved patient outcomes. The increasing adoption of Holter ECG devices, driven by rising cardiovascular disease prevalence including 4,500 heart attack cases reported nationwide in May 2023, has been instrumental in accelerating market growth. Additionally, the integration of wearable technology advancements, artificial intelligence and machine learning capabilities, and remote patient monitoring systems are transforming cardiac care delivery and expanding market opportunities.
Kuwait City is the dominant region in the market due to its advanced healthcare infrastructure and concentration of specialized medical facilities. The city benefits from a high standard of living and increased healthcare spending, which supports the adoption of innovative medical technologies. Additionally, the presence of key healthcare institutions and a growing awareness of heart health among the population further contribute to its market leadership.
Kuwait's healthcare sector operates under the oversight of the Ministry of Health (MOH), which enforces the Medical Devices Regulation Law No. 25 of 2016. This legislation establishes comprehensive requirements for the registration, import, distribution, and use of medical devices, including arrhythmia monitoring equipment. The law mandates that all medical devices must obtain approval from the MOH before being marketed or used in healthcare facilities, with specific standards for safety, efficacy, and quality control. Devices are classified based on risk levels, with higher-risk cardiac monitoring equipment subject to rigorous premarket evaluation, clinical data submission, and ongoing post-market surveillance. Healthcare facilities must ensure compliance with installation, maintenance, and operational protocols, while distributors are required to maintain proper documentation and traceability throughout the supply chain.
Kuwait Arrhythmia Monitoring Devices Market Segmentation
By Type:
The market is segmented into various types of arrhythmia monitoring devices, including Holter Monitors, Event Monitors, Implantable Loop Recorders, Mobile Cardiac Telemetry Devices, Wearable ECG Monitors, Remote Patient Monitoring Systems, ECG Management Software, and Others. Among these, Holter Monitors and Wearable ECG Monitors are gaining significant traction due to their convenience and ability to provide continuous monitoring. The increasing consumer preference for non-invasive and user-friendly devices is driving the growth of these segments.
By End-User:
The end-user segmentation includes Hospitals, Cardiology Clinics, Home Healthcare, Diagnostic Laboratories, Ambulatory Surgical Centers, and Others. Hospitals are the leading end-users due to their comprehensive cardiac care services and the need for advanced monitoring solutions. The increasing number of cardiac procedures and the emphasis on patient safety and monitoring in hospital settings are driving the demand for arrhythmia monitoring devices.

Kuwait Arrhythmia Monitoring Devices Market Industry Analysis
Growth Drivers
Increasing Prevalence of Arrhythmias:
The prevalence of arrhythmias in Kuwait is rising, with approximately 1.5 million individuals affected by various heart rhythm disorders in future. This increase is attributed to lifestyle changes, including high rates of obesity and diabetes, which affect 35% and 25% of the adult population, respectively. The growing patient base drives demand for arrhythmia monitoring devices, as healthcare providers seek effective solutions to manage these conditions and improve patient outcomes.
Advancements in Monitoring Technology:
Technological innovations in arrhythmia monitoring devices are transforming patient care. In future, the introduction of devices featuring real-time data transmission and AI-driven analytics is expected to enhance diagnostic accuracy. The global market for wearable health technology is projected to reach $60 billion, with a significant portion attributed to cardiac monitoring devices. These advancements facilitate timely interventions, thereby increasing the adoption of such devices in Kuwait's healthcare system.
Rising Healthcare Expenditure:
Kuwait's healthcare expenditure is projected to reach $8.5 billion in future, reflecting a commitment to improving health services. This increase is driven by government initiatives aimed at enhancing healthcare infrastructure and access to advanced medical technologies. As healthcare spending rises, hospitals and clinics are more likely to invest in arrhythmia monitoring devices, thereby expanding the market and improving patient care capabilities across the nation.
Market Challenges
High Cost of Advanced Devices:
The high cost of advanced arrhythmia monitoring devices poses a significant barrier to market growth in Kuwait. Many state-of-the-art devices range from $1,500 to $5,000, making them unaffordable for a substantial portion of the population. This financial constraint limits access to necessary monitoring solutions, particularly in public healthcare settings, where budget allocations are often insufficient to cover such expenses.
Limited Reimbursement Policies:
The lack of comprehensive reimbursement policies for arrhythmia monitoring devices in Kuwait presents a challenge for market expansion. Currently, only 40% of healthcare providers offer reimbursement for these devices, which discourages patients from seeking necessary monitoring. This limitation affects the overall adoption rate of advanced technologies, as many patients are unable to afford out-of-pocket expenses for essential health monitoring solutions.
